Kenneth J. Self, 69, passed from this life on Friday morning, April 12, 2024 at his residence in his sleep. He was born November 3, 1954, in Chillicothe, the son of Kenneth and Geraldine Self. In 2005, he married his best friend, Brenda Martin.
Kenneth is survived by his mother, Geraldine Seymour, of Frankfort, OH; two sisters, Cindy (Roma) Self, of Chillicothe, OH and Marian (Dirck) Everhart, of Frankfort, OH; a brother, Charles and Tonya Seymour, of Vinton County; four children, Gary Steven Martin (Tammy), of Chillicothe, OH, Christy Luman (Jim), of Hillsboro, OH, Sara Evans, of Urbana, OH and Melissa Numberger (Thad), of Chillicothe, OH. Kenneth was a grandfather to eight and great grandfather to ten. Kenneth was preceded in death, by his wife, Brenda Self (Martin) in 2020; his mother-in-law, Genive Vickers; and father, Kenneth Self; father-in-law, Thamer Vickers and Don Seymour; and stepbrother, Donnie Seymour.
Kenneth was a loving son, husband, father, grandfather, great grandfather and friend who will be greatly missed. He was a devoted Christian and an active member of the First Capital Christian Church. Over the years, Kenneth served by preaching, teaching the youth, and working in many various outreach projects, such as Holiday Smiles and feeding those in need. Kenneth was an ordained minister and a notary public. Kenneth loved helping whenever and wherever he could. Even in his youth his love and wellbeing of others was shown, as he proudly served in the Junior Deputies, during High School.
